BP/MoS₂ Van Der Waals Heterojunctions for Self‐Powered Photoconduction

open access: yesAdvanced Optical Materials, EarlyView.
A multilayer black phosphorus (BP)/monolayer MoS₂ vertical heterostructure is investigated using four‐probe measurements. The device exhibits rectifying behavior, dominant n‐type transport, low contact resistance, and an interface barrier of 68 meV.
